NOVELTY - High-temperature resistant nano-graphene flame-retardant coating comprises high-strength special ternary flame-retardant resin as base material, graphene nano-elements, high-efficient fireproof intumescent flame-retardant, dehydrated charcoal catalyst, foaming agent, and carbonization reinforcing agent. USE - High-temperature resistant nano-graphene flame-retardant coating used in fireproofing sites, ancient buildings, hospitals, hotels, schools, high-grade buildings, and exterior fireproof coatings of villa buildings. ADVANTAGE - The coating has excellent high-temperature resistant and flame retardance. DETAILED DESCRIPTION - An INDEPENDENT CLAIM is included for preparation of high-temperature resistant nano-graphene flame-retardant coating, which involves oxidizing graphene oxide, where the graphite oxide still retains the layered structure of graphite, number of oxygen-based functional groups are introduced in each layer of graphene monolithic, and then synergistic effect of variety of fire retardants more likely to show doubling of the flame retardant effect is achieved using combination of size and area effect of nano-particles and flame-retardant technology.
